Listed here are some helpful tips for slot players.

Use Your Players CardIf I MAY give just one tip to casino players, this may be the only I'D pick. Your player’s club card can earn you comps for food, lodging, and shows. Some casinos even offer cash back in your play. While you don't use the cardboard you're essentially depriving yourself of the precious incentives the casino is giving back to the players. Some slot players think that using their slot cards affect the way in which a machines pays out. It is a myth and an overly expensive mistake for individuals who believe it.

Read the Pay TablesLooking on the pay table of the machine permit you to judge the frequency that the machine returns a winner. If you happen to see that there are numerous combinations that return smaller wins, then this machine will usually have a bigger hit frequency than person who has fewer winning combinations that pay back larger wins. Some players like numerous smaller wins more often.

Play Full Coin in Progressive Machines.Progressive machines offer large jackpots. The massive progressive jackpot is made by taking a percentage of all of the money played into the machine. You'll be able to only win the progressive jackpot in case you have are playing the utmost choice of coins. Don’t play these machines in the event you don’t plan to try this.

Slot Candles The lights at the top of the machines are called candles. The ground light is colored and that color can inform you the denomination of the machine. In most cases, the candles on dollar machines are blue, Quarters are yellow, and nickel machines are red.

Lock Up a Profit Should you hit a jackpot, just remember to “lock up” a profit. Take your initial playing stakes and a bit profit and set it aside. Then play with a small percentage of you winnings. There may be nothing worse than the sensation of being a winner after which giving back all of your winnings to the casino. I LIKE TO RECOMMEND taking a bit break after a hitting a jackpot. Savor the win and luxuriate in that winning feeling.

Keep a LogIf you hit a jackpot over $1,200 you'll be given a W2-G and your winnings can be reported to the IRS. When you keep a correct gaming log, you should use your losses to offset your winnings come tax time.

Slow Down Decelerate when you find yourself playing slot machines. There are not any prizes for the player hitting the spin button the fastest. Don’t play multiple machine at a time. Playing a couple of machine just exposes you more to the home edge. In the end you are going to just lose your money faster.

Manage your Money Never bring money to the casino that you just need for other expenses. Should you can’t afford to lose it then you definitely shouldn’t be playing it within the casino. Break you casino bankroll down into several playing sessions. Don’t risk all of it in a single playing session.

Cashing Out. If you end up done playing, just remember to take your entire coins from the tray or your voucher ticket from the machine. Do that in no time before you collect your individual belongings. Go on to the cage. Don’t walk around with a bucket of coins. They are often spilled or lost in case you set them down. If you're playing a coinless machine that pays you with a paper voucher be sure you cash it in. A few of these have an expiration date making them worthless after a definite time period.

Don’t Purchase Slot Systems. Slot systems that claim they may be able to show you which ones machine is able to hit are a scam. The Random Number Generator (RNG)determines the winning combinations of the machine. There is not any method to determine if a machine is “due” to hit.

Have Fun Slot machines have a bigger house edge than other casino games. While winning is nice, ultimately it is going to cost your cash to play. Have a look at this cost as your price for entertainment. Pick a machine that you've got fun playing and revel in yourself.
